- 시간 & Booking Window: Last-minute reservations often feature higher rates due to scarcity. Booking 3–7 days in advance typically secures better pricing.
- Base Rental Rate: This depends heavily on vehicle class (compact, midsize, SUV), rental duration (one day preferred), and towing needs. Compact cars average $25–$40/day, while larger vehicles and crossovers hover $40–$80.
- Promotions & Discounts: Rental platforms frequently offer flash deals, student discounts, and loyalty rewards—especially when booked mobile-first.

Using these factors, a realistic one-day rate ranges from $25 to $100, with urban airports and luxury pickups approaching the upper end. Digital tools now calculate personalized quotes by factoring in real-time data, ensuring users see the most current, accurate cost.
Rental markets remain dynamic—prices vary by region, season, and availability. While urban centers command higher rates, rural and suburban areas offer savings. Timing matters: mid-week rentals with advance bookings consistently yield lower costs.
Transparency is key. Platforms offering full cost breakdowns—especially when filtered by pickup location, vehicle class, and pay-as-you-go options—empower users to navigate without guesswork. Critical awareness of all-inclusive pricing protects against hidden expenses.
What fees apply if you exceed daily mileage limits?
Overraise mileage charges range from $0.25 to $0.75 per mile depending on provider. Using a GPS-enabled vehicle without exceeding limits helps avoid surprises.
The real cost of renting a car for one day isn’t just the daily rate displayed at the counter. It’s a layered calculation involving several factors:

A round-trip reservation—returning the car at the original location—usually saves money compared to one-way pricing, which includes a return surcharge.
